
Tonight’s episode of WWE RAW promises to be an exciting one, with several intriguing developments on the horizon.
Jey Uso, who has returned to the RAW roster, is set to kick off the broadcast, setting the stage for what’s to come.
Damian Priest, the new Undisputed WWE Tag Team Champion, will receive a custom Money In The Bank briefcase, one that will be purple.
Sami Zayn is confirmed to appear on RAW and is scheduled for a match, although it remains unclear whether Kevin Owens will also make an appearance after they lost the Undisputed WWE Tag Team Titles to Priest and Finn Balor at Payback.
The main event for tonight’s RAW will feature Chad Gable challenging WWE Intercontinental Champion GUNTHER. Gable’s big night is teased, with the possibility of a significant development.

The following matches and segments have also been revealed:
- Jey Uso promo to open the show
- The Viking Raiders vs. Drew McIntyre and Matt Riddle in a Tag Team Tornado match. Kofi Kingston was planned to be at ringside for the match at some point
- Promo from WWE World Heavyweight Champion Seth Rollins
- Ricochet vs. Shinsuke Nakamura
- Promo with The Judgment Day
- Shayna Baszler vs. Zoey Stark
- Raquel Rodriguez vs. WWE Women’s Tag Team Champion Chelsea Green
- Promo with The Miz
- Sami Zayn vs. JD McDonagh
- WWE Intercontinental Champion GUNTHER defends against Chad Gable
- Gable vs. GUNTHER is scheduled for three segments and the main event, which is an incredible amount of time. The other matches are set for two segments, except Rodriguez vs. Green
